Logistics Operations Associate information

What challenges might a logistics operations associate face?

Logistics Operations Associates frequently encounter challenges such as managing tight delivery schedules, responding to unexpected delays or disruptions in the supply chain, and ensuring accurate inventory tracking. Working closely with vendors, carriers, and internal teams requires strong communication skills and the ability to quickly resolve issues as they arise. Adapting to changing priorities and utilizing logistics management software are key components of the role, making flexibility and attention to detail essential for success.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a logistics operations associate?

To thrive as a Logistics Operations Associate, you need a solid understanding of supply chain processes, inventory management principles, and typically a bachelor’s degree in logistics or a related field. Familiarity with warehouse management systems (WMS), enterprise resource planning (ERP) software, and transportation management tools is often required.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and effective communication are essential soft skills in this role. These abilities are vital for ensuring efficient operations, minimizing errors, and supporting smooth coordination across the logistics network.

What is a logistics operations associate?

Logistics Operations Associates are professionals responsible for coordinating and overseeing the daily activities involved in the movement, distribution, and storage of goods within a supply chain. They ensure that shipments are processed efficiently, inventory levels are maintained, and deliveries meet customer requirements. Their duties often include tracking shipments, resolving transportation issues, communicating with vendors and customers, and supporting the overall logistics process. This role is crucial in ensuring that products reach their destinations on time and in good condition.

What is the difference between Logistics Operations Associate vs Warehouse Associate?

AspectLogistics Operations AssociateWarehouse Associate
Primary FocusManaging logistics processes, coordinating shipments, optimizing supply chain operationsHandling inventory, packing, and physical movement of goods within a warehouse
Required SkillsLogistics software, supply chain knowledge, communication skillsPhysical stamina, inventory management, forklift operation
Work EnvironmentOffice settings, logistics centers, distribution hubsWarehouse floors, storage facilities
Common CertificationsLogistics or supply chain certifications often preferredForklift certification, OSHA safety training

The Logistics Operations Associate focuses on coordinating and managing supply chain activities, often working in office or logistics centers. In contrast, the Warehouse Associate primarily handles physical tasks within warehouses, such as inventory handling and packing. Both roles are essential in the logistics industry but differ in responsibilities and work environments.

Can I work in logistics with no experience?

Logistics Operations Associate roles often do not require prior experience, as many employers provide on-the-job training. Basic skills in organization, communication, and familiarity with inventory or transportation software can be helpful for entry-level positions.
